Transaction 6bf3a1b99584f9c56588aa416f54950223c71d1f7e24de8e2af4c7841a6c1615

4 Input
2 Outputs
  • 6bf3a1b99584f9c56588aa416f54950223c71d1f7e24de8e2af4c7841a6c1615:0
  • value  15218899
    address  3D1yN49BMRaGvzoR98yNSeAuCF2WQ8TR3i
  • 6bf3a1b99584f9c56588aa416f54950223c71d1f7e24de8e2af4c7841a6c1615:1
  • value  499149999
    address  3GRtkxKKYLbPvXafVAuUiDzzPNTm3LmgrC